Bathroom Floor Replacement Questions

What materials are suitable for bathroom floor replacement? Popular options include ceramic, porcelain, vinyl, and natural stone, each offering durability and style for bathroom floors.

Can bathroom floors be replaced without significant disruption? Yes, many replacement projects can be completed efficiently, minimizing inconvenience and downtime.

What should property owners consider before replacing a bathroom floor? It's important to evaluate existing subfloor conditions, waterproofing needs, and the desired aesthetic to ensure a successful upgrade.

Is it necessary to remove all old flooring before installing new material? Typically, the existing flooring is removed to prepare a clean, level surface for the new installation, ensuring better longevity and appearance.
